Since starting in IADT we were introduced to Dribbble. Dribbble is a community of graphic and web designers. Work is uploaded to showcase or to receive feedback. I frequently browse the site looking for ideas and  inspiration. I also use a app for mac called Dropmark which allows me to save these in collections. 

In my last site I used a Typekit font 'Museo Sans' , one downside to typekit is that it wont work on a local host. Instead I used google fonts. Very easy to apply and works on a local host. The fonts I used are 'Droid Sans' and 'Pacifico'.

I had the idea of a NAV similar to the Facebook slider but this turned out to be a lot of work. I designed up a NAV that was similar across all devices and easy to use.

One idea that is seen on many portfolio sites is the idea of a timeline. Except most of these are simply background images with DIV's positioned absolutely to it, I wanted to create one with CSS (not an easy task).
